This novel delves into the complex and controversial life of Jiang Qing, who rose from humble beginnings as an actress in Shanghai to become Madame Mao, a central figure in the Chinese Communist Party and the Cultural Revolution. The narrative traces her personal ambitions, her relationship with Mao Zedong, and her eventual fall from power, offering a nuanced portrayal of a woman often vilified in history.
